Atlas of Ruins Vol.3 — Call for Photos
Atlas of Ruins is a recurring photo book series published by Reuse Italy, a cultural benefit corporation focused on reusing historical heritage through partnerships with architects, institutions, and national organizations. Vol.3 follows two earlier volumes (Vol.1 and Vol.2), both available for purchase on the Reuse Italy site.
The theme is architectural ruins from any historical period and any location worldwide — the open geographical and historical scope means submissions span everything from Roman antiquity through twentieth-century industrial decay. Entries can come from photographers, amateurs, students, architects, or designers, and individuals or collectives may participate.
Cash prizes: 1st place €1,200, 2nd €500, 3rd €300. Country mentions go to the best photo from each represented nation, and all participants receive an ebook copy of the published volume regardless of selection. Selected work appears in the printed Atlas of Ruins — Vol.3 with critical texts from international scholars.
Entry fees follow a tiered structure: early registration (until July 9, 2026) costs €13 for one photo or €25 for 2–10; regular registration (until October 1, 2026) costs €16 for one or €30 for 2–10. VAT is added separately. Submissions are JPEG, minimum 1200 pixels on the longest side, under 5MB, with no logos or watermarks. Higher-resolution files and location data are requested after selection.
